The Wausau Timbers of the Midwest League ended the 1983 season with a record of 55 wins and 83 losses, finishing fourth in the league's North Division.
The Timbers scored 613 runs and surrendered 784 runs, most in the circuit. Dave Smith led Wausau with 26 home runs, and Chip Conklin walloped 15 or more, too. Dave Smith drove in 80 runs. Dave Myers paced all regular hitters by hitting .301. Bob Baldrick topped the squad with 10 wins and a team-best 3.4 ERA, best among qualifying pitchers.
Members of the 1983 Wausau Timbers who played in Major League Baseball during their careers were John Poloni, Terry Bell and Terry Taylor.
